Public urged to honour workers’ day

WEST Lothian residents are being encouraged to attend a ceremony to mark Workers’ Memorial Day.

The international day of remembrance for workers killed in accidents at work, or by diseases caused by work, is recognised as a national day in many countries. The West Lothian event will take place at Bathgate Sports Centre on April 28 at 12.30pm.

Event organiser Jim Swan said: “We hope that as many people as possible will come along to the ceremony – everyone is welcome and the event is free.

This is a chance to remember loved ones who have died from a work-related illness. There are also a limited number of spaces available for a free Workers’ Memorial Day seminar with key speakers at the Sports Centre, which starts at 10am.”
